Relationship between endothelial function and skeletal muscle strength in community dwelling elderly women.

Abstract

BACKGROUND

The aim of this study is to determine whether there is correlation between endothelial function and skeletal muscle function measured by hand grip strength in elderly women.

METHODS

This cross-sectional study used data of NAMGARAM-2 cohort. The NAMGARAM-2 cohort consisted of a group of people living in three rural communities. They were enrolled for studies on activity limitation due to age-related musculoskeletal disorders including knee osteoarthritis, osteoporosis, and sarcopenia. They were residents aged 40 years or older. They agreed to participate in this cohort from March 2016 to May 2017. Peripheral endothelial function was assessed by reactive hyperaemia-peripheral arterial tonometry using EndoPAT2000 system. Hand grip strength was measured using a digital hand dynamometer.

RESULTS

Endothelial function index assessed by EndoPAT was worse in the low grip strength group than that in the normal group of elderly women (1.54 ± 0.51 in the low grip strength group vs. 1.77 ± 0.67 in the normal group, P = 0.003). There was a positive correlation between hand grip strength and endothelial function (r = 0.176, P = 0.007). On stepwise multivariate analysis, endothelial dysfunction (reactive hyperaemia-peripheral arterial tonometry index < 1.67) significantly increased the risk of low hand grip strength (odds ratio = 2.019; 95% confidence interval = 1.107-3.682; P = 0.022).

CONCLUSIONS

Endothelial function and skeletal muscle strength had a significant correlation in elderly women, providing additional support for the relevant role of vascular system in sarcopenia.

摘要

背景

本研究旨在确定老年女性的内皮功能与握力所测骨骼肌功能之间是否存在相关性。

方法

本横断面研究使用了 NAMGARAM-2 队列的数据。NAMGARAM-2 队列由居住在三个农村社区的人群组成。他们因年龄相关的肌肉骨骼疾病(包括膝骨关节炎、骨质疏松症和肌肉减少症)而活动受限,参加了这些研究。他们是年龄在 40 岁或以上的居民。他们同意于 2016 年 3 月至 2017 年 5 月参加该队列。使用 EndoPAT2000 系统通过反应性充血-外周动脉张力测定法评估外周内皮功能。使用数字握力计测量握力。

结果

握力较低组的内皮功能指数(通过 EndoPAT 评估)比握力正常组的老年女性更差(握力较低组为 1.54±0.51,握力正常组为 1.77±0.67,P=0.003)。握力与内皮功能之间存在正相关(r=0.176,P=0.007)。在逐步多元分析中,内皮功能障碍(反应性充血-外周动脉张力测定指数<1.67)显著增加握力较低的风险(比值比=2.019;95%置信区间=1.107-3.682;P=0.022)。

结论

在老年女性中,内皮功能和骨骼肌力量之间存在显著相关性,为血管系统在肌肉减少症中的相关作用提供了额外的支持。
